Patrolman Ira Burgess was shot and killed when he and a police captain responded to reports of a man threatening to kill his wife at 1446 Willow Street.

When they arrived at the man's house they began to take cover but the man came out with a shotgun and opened fire. Patrolman Burgess was shot as he attempted to draw his pistol. The suspect was then shot and killed by a city workhouse guard who was supervising a nearby work crew.

Patrolman Burgess had served with the Kingsport Police Department for five years and had previously served as a part-time deputy for the Hawkins County Sheriff's Office for 16 years.
